[QUOTE="Michael Eichele, post: 297977, member: 1007"] This may sounds odd, but I am using the standard 338 RUM FL and seater dies and are working flawlessly. My chamber is cut VERY snug so my brass doesnt expand but a couple thou at the shoulder. When I run the cases into the die to just touch (NOT bump) the shoulder, they come out the exact same size they went in. The only difference is the neck is a .002" smaller. Every now and then I can feel a shoulder "bump" just a hair. I dont know if they would work for everybody but their working for me. [/QUOTE]
